Blood Product Utilization with Left Ventricular Assist Device Implantation: A Decade of Statewide Data

Blood transfusions remain high for left ventricular assist device (LVAD) implantation, but the total units transfused decreased over the decade studied. This indicates a potential shift in transfusion practices for these complex cardiac surgeries.

Background:

  • Declining blood transfusion rates are observed in cardiac surgery.
  • Trends in blood product utilization for left ventricular assist device (LVAD) implantation are not well-established.
  • LVAD implantation is a complex procedure often associated with significant bleeding risks.

Purpose of the Study:

  • To investigate blood transfusion trends in patients undergoing LVAD implantation over a 10-year period.
  • To identify factors associated with blood product use during LVAD surgery.
  • To analyze changes in the volume of blood products transfused over time.

Main Methods:

  • Retrospective analysis of a statewide database including 666 LVAD implantations from July 2004 to June 2014.
  • Examination of intraoperative and postoperative blood product usage (plasma, platelets, RBCs, cryoprecipitate).
  • Multivariable analysis to identify preoperative predictors of blood transfusion.

Main Results:

  • Blood product utilization remained high, with 92% of patients receiving transfusions.
  • Significant reduction in the average units of blood transfused was observed in the latter 5 years (2010-2014) compared to the first 5 years (2005-2009).
  • Preoperative factors associated with transfusion included lower hematocrit, lower BMI, reoperative surgery, intraaortic balloon pump use, and nonelective surgery.

Conclusions:

  • Blood transfusion remains a frequent occurrence in LVAD implantation.
  • While overall transfusion rates are high, there has been a decrease in the quantity of blood products transfused in recent years.
  • Identifying predictive factors for transfusion can aid in optimizing perioperative management.
